3. Studies Supporting Reading Benefits

Reading has been proven to have a positive effect on the brain, and multiple studies have been conducted to further explore the benefits of reading.

A study conducted by the University of Sussex found that reading can reduce stress levels by up to 68%. The study involved participants reading for just six minutes, and the results showed that reading was more effective at reducing stress than listening to music, drinking tea, or taking a walk.

Another study conducted by Emory University showed that reading can increase brain connectivity. The study looked at the brain scans of participants before and after they read a novel, and the results showed that the areas of the brain associated with language, memory, and visual processing were more connected after reading.

A study conducted by the University of Toronto found that reading can improve empathy. The study involved participants reading literature that focused on the thoughts and feelings of characters, and the results showed that the participants had a better understanding of the emotions of others after reading.

Finally, a study conducted by the University of Liverpool showed that reading can improve mental health. The study focused on participants who were experiencing depression and anxiety, and the results showed that reading had a positive effect on their mental health.

These studies demonstrate the positive effects that reading can have on the brain. Reading can reduce stress, increase brain connectivity, improve empathy, and improve mental health. It is clear that reading is an important activity that can benefit both our physical and mental health.

4. How to Incorporate Reading Into Your Life

Reading is a great way to improve your brain, but it can be difficult to prioritize it in your life. Here are some tips to help you incorporate reading into your life and reap the benefits:

  1. Schedule Time: Set aside a certain amount of time each day to read. Whether it’s 15 minutes before bed or an hour on the weekends, make sure you set aside time to read.

  2. Choose the Right Material: Pick books or articles that you find interesting and enjoyable. This will make it easier to stick to your reading schedule and make the reading experience more enjoyable.

  3. Make It Social: Join a book club or find an online forum to discuss what you’re reading. This will help you stay motivated and focused on reading.

  4. Take Breaks: Don’t be afraid to take breaks while reading. This can help you stay focused and absorb more information.

  5. Listen to Audiobooks: If you’re short on time, consider listening to audiobooks. This can be a great way to fit reading into a busy schedule.

  6. Try Different Genres: Experiment with different genres. Reading outside of your comfort zone can help you develop new skills and interests.

  7. Read With Your Kids: Reading with your kids can be a great way to bond and teach them the importance of reading.
